Output 84577817c7052acd7ad214788d6d7c4124f6de82c5b93e6d1e7714e315773103:0

value
103287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4ff423b31884933c4eb9ff61a06a875f61cad9 OP_EQUAL
address
3PEXB6Qo11Ev88kixuJy9R9E69ktWMjJiR
transaction
84577817c7052acd7ad214788d6d7c4124f6de82c5b93e6d1e7714e315773103